Wireless sensor networks consist of sensor nodes which has the capabilities of perception, computing and communication. These nodes form a self-organization network through the mode of many-to-one, and transmit the collected data to the sink nodes through the way of multi-hop. WSN is not only one of the new IT industry in the21st century, but also one of the four pillar industries of the21st century high-tech fields. Due to the limitation of node energy, the design of routing protocol which can effectively save energy and prolong the lifetime of network has become a hot-spot in WSN research.The paper introduced the existing routing protocol in WSN, and proposed a reliable energy-balanced routing protocol after analyzing readily available protocols. The protocol establishes a global network topology in the initial stage, and then selects the next hop node according to energy cost function and updates node’s reliability information when there are obstacles above the node. With the consideration of the nodes’residual energy, hops, the distance of the neighbors and reliability factors, our protocol balanced the energy consumption of the nodes and effectively prolonged the lifetime of the network.We simulated the reliable energy-balanced routing protocol on the MATLAB platform and compared it with the Shortest-path routing algorithm in the aspects of lifetime, the average energy consumption and the energy variance of the network, which turns out that the algorithm, is superior to others.
